#687ddd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#687ddd is composed of 40.8% red, 49%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.9% cyan, 43.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 229.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 63.7%. #687ddd color hex could be obtained by blending #d0faff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#687ddd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#687ddd has RGB values of R:104, G:125,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 6847965.

Shades and Tints of #687ddd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020309 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fd is the lightest one.
